(fn. 1) Paymenttes ffor the Chirche.

* * * * *

Item, more to ye organ maker ffor a Reward for tuenyng of ye pipis xij d
Item, spent on hym & dyuiers of the Cumpany at ye ale howse vj d
Item, paid for iij staf torches of wex, to hold at the levacion ij s vj d
* * * * *
Item, spent vppon them yat went with me to seynt Kateryns to take a stresse at godffrey ffelyns howse, and the Constable withe other of neyghpers xij d
* * * * *
Item, ffor makynge of ye cokk of ye bosse at bylyngesgate and settyng in of the same xvj d
* * * * *
Item, paid ffor makyng of a pykaxe ffor the Chirch iiij d
Item, ffor mendyng of ye berrell' crosse yat was brokyn iij s iiij d
* * * * *
(fn. 2) Item, ffor Ryngyng of ye gret bell' ffor Master Ryvell' vj owres vj d
* * * * *
Item, ffor a crosse to set in ye pardon chircheyard by ye pale j d
Item, ffor nayles to make ffast the yrons in the Rode lofte To set in the baners j d
Item, ffor mendyng of ye lock yat stondith on ye almery behynd the vestry dore & makynge of a key to the same iiij d
Item, paid ffor a key ffor the steple dore iij d
Item, paid to a smythe ffor a bolt ffor the northe chirchyarde dore and ij kepars and a staple iiij d
* * * * *
Item, paid to thomas coldale ffor blowyng of ye organs ffor lij wekes, that ys to say, ffor euery wek ij d viij s viij d
Item, paid ffor iij galons iij quartes & j pynt of malvesey ffor owr lady masse ffor the hole yere iij s x d ob.

(fn. 3) Clarkes wages and beame ligh't.

Rec' ffor the Clarkes wages this yere as yt apperethe by the Rowle of Gatherynge of the same vij l'i xvij s j d
Rec' ffor ye pascall money & ye beame light this yere xij s ij d quarter
Summa of thes Receytes, viij l'i ix s iij d quarter.

Paymentes.

ffirst, paid to edmond matrevers ffor his yeres wages x l'i
Item, paid to mychaell gren, Conducte, ffor his yeres wages viij l'i
Item, paid to Wylliam paten, ye Clark, ffor his yeres wages vj l'i xiij s iiij d
Item, to donston checheley, conducte, ffor iij quarters wages vj l'i
Item, to nycholas crase, conducte, ffor di. yere & di. quarteres [wages] v l'i
Item, to Richard newgate, conducte, ffor his yeres wages vij l'i
Item, to thomas hoggeson, sexten, ffor his yeres wages iij l'i vj s viij d
Summa of thes paymentes, xlvj l'i.
So the charges amountes ouer and above the Receytes, xxxvij l'i x s viij d ob. quarter.

(fn. 4) Casuall Receytes this yere.

Rec' of thomas Cokkes ffor the pytt of Agnes vavyser in the pardon Chirche yarde iij s iiij d
Rec' ffor her knyll' with the gret bell' vj owres vj s viij d
Item, Rec' ffor ye pyt & knyll ffor master Ryvell' xiij s iiij d
Item, Rec' ffor the stone that lythe over hym vj s viij d
Rec' ffor the pytt of sir george Robyns vj s viij d
Summa of thes Receytes, xxxvj s viij d.
